Transaction 888be1e8131334eaeb06ff4a8ce6f95d436bfa70daea64d4bb869ef79cfed60d
1 Input
1 Output
-
888be1e8131334eaeb06ff4a8ce6f95d436bfa70daea64d4bb869ef79cfed60d:0
- value
- 186414
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44f94e4f4636a126a15779c2f9516c4d018d0069 OP_EQUAL
- address
- 37yiXfZSK9khhHn9pwdEqjB4BMM7fK4FPN